Essential Scuba Masks

A quality scuba mask is necessary for any diver, as it provides a vital barrier between the underwater world and the diver's eyesight. Right fit and comfort are critical, as an ill-fitting mask can result in discomfort and compromise visibility. The lens material, commonly tempered glass, offers durability and clarity, while a skirt made from silicone ensures a watertight seal against the face. Masks can be found in different styles, including single and double lenses, allowing divers to choose based on individual needs and visibility needs. Furthermore, some masks have integrated features such as prescription lenses or integrated cameras. Selecting the right scuba mask contributes substantially to the overall diving experience, increasing safety and enjoyment beneath the waves.

Different Fin Types

In selecting fins for best performance, divers should consider numerous types designed to improve movement and efficiency underwater. There are primarily two categories of fins: open-heel and full-foot. Open-heel fins are versatile, allowing divers to wear neoprene booties for extra warmth and protection, making them ideal for colder waters. Full-foot fins, in contrast, are lightweight and well-suited for warm waters, providing a snug fit without the need for additional gear. Additionally, divers may choose between paddle fins, known for their flexible propulsion, and split fins, which offer reduced drag and increased efficiency. Each type of fin serves discover more certain diving styles and conditions, enabling divers to optimize their underwater experience.

Wetsuit Thickness Considerations

In establishing the correct wetsuit thickness, divers should evaluate several factors, including water temperature, length of exposure, and personal cold tolerance. As a rule, wetsuit thickness ranges from 2mm to 7mm, with thicker suits providing more insulation for colder waters. In tropical climates, a 2-3mm wetsuit or even a shorty might be sufficient, while temperatures below 60°F usually require a 5mm suit. For colder conditions, such as those below 50°F, a 7mm wetsuit is frequently recommended. Moreover, divers should consider the planned dive duration; longer exposures may necessitate thicker suits to retain warmth. Ultimately, selecting the right wetsuit thickness is critical for guaranteeing comfort and safety during underwater adventures.

Comprehending Scuba Regulators

How does a scuba regulator guarantee a safe and enjoyable diving experience? A scuba regulator is a critical component that lowers high-pressure air from the tank to a breathable level, permitting divers to breathe comfortably underwater. It functions in two stages: the first stage links to the tank and decreases pressure, while the second stage supplies air on demand as the diver breathes. This design guarantees that divers get a stable airflow irrespective of depth. Additionally, regulators are outfitted with safety features, such as a purge button, that permits divers to clear water rapidly. Regular maintenance and proper fitting boost performance, assuring reliability. Understanding the functionality and care of a scuba regulator is crucial for every diver seeking safety and comfort during their underwater adventures.

Buoyancy Control Systems (BCDs)

What role do Buoyancy Control Devices (BCDs) play in elevating a diver's experience? BCDs are essential for maintaining neutral buoyancy, allowing divers to ascend, descend, or remain at a specific depth smoothly. These devices are fitted with air bladders that can be inflated or deflated, allowing divers to control their buoyancy with precision. By using a BCD, divers can preserve stamina, increase comfort, and boost safety during dives. Proper buoyancy control also decreases the risk of damaging fragile underwater ecosystems. Furthermore, BCDs often feature integrated weights, pockets for storing accessories, and attachment points for essential gear. In summary, BCDs significantly enhance the overall enjoyment and safety of the diving experience, making them indispensable for both new and seasoned divers.

Supplementary Gear for Divers

A well-equipped diver understands the importance of additional accessories that enhance both safety and enjoyment underwater. Essential items such as a dive knife provide a means of protection and a tool for emergencies, while a surface marker buoy (SMB) enhances visibility during ascents. A dive computer is essential for tracking depth and time, assisting divers evade decompression sickness. A waterproof flashlight is invaluable for illuminating dark areas and signaling to dive partners. Divers should also consider a wetsuit or drysuit for thermal protection, and a reliable pair of fins to increase mobility. Carrying a mesh bag for gear organization and a first aid kit provides preparedness for minor injuries. These accessories collectively contribute to a safer and more enjoyable diving experience.

What Is the Correct Way to Maintain My Scuba Gear?

To properly maintain scuba gear, divers should rinse equipment with fresh water after each dive, frequently examine for signs of wear, store equipment in a cool, dry environment, and observe the manufacturer's recommendations for regular servicing and component replacement.
